10 Unique Workspace Design Hacks for the Creative Professional
Creating an inspiring workspace is essential for any creative professional. Here are 10 unique workspace design hacks to elevate your creativity:
- Incorporate Natural Light: Position your desk near a window to maximize exposure to natural light, which can boost mood and productivity.
- Use a Vision Board: Create a visual representation of your goals and aspirations. This can be a physical board or a digital version that you can reference frequently.
- Add Greenery: Plants not only enhance aesthetics, but they also improve air quality and reduce stress.
- Personalize Your Space: Use artwork, photographs, or objects that inspire you and make the workspace feel like your own.
- Invest in Ergonomic Furniture: Ensure comfort and support by choosing ergonomic chairs and desks.
Continuing with more workspace design hacks, consider these elements:
- Create Zones: Designate different areas for various tasks, such as a reading nook or a brainstorming corner.
- Experiment with Color: Use color psychology to influence your mood. For instance, blues can create a calm atmosphere, while yellows can stimulate creativity.
- Minimize Clutter: Keep your workspace organized and clutter-free to enhance focus.
- Include Inspirational Quotes: Post motivational quotes around your workspace to keep your spirits high and inspire creativity.
- Use Multi-functional Furniture: Opt for furniture that serves multiple purposes, such as a desk that doubles as a storage unit.

How to Personalize Your Office Space: Tips for the Quirky Professional
Personalizing your office space is essential for the quirky professional who wants to infuse their personality into their work environment. Start by adding unique decor that resonates with your interests; this might include colorful artwork, eclectic wall hangings, or quirky figurines. Consider incorporating plants, such as succulents or ferns, which not only enhance the aesthetic but also improve air quality and mood. Mix and match styles to create an atmosphere that inspires creativity—think vintage, modern, or even a touch of whimsy!
Another crucial aspect to consider is your workspace layout. Ensure that your desk setup is both functional and visually appealing. Use organizers that reflect your style—perhaps a funky pen holder or a retro desk lamp. Moreover, adding personal touches like framed photographs or a vision board can help you stay motivated. Remember, your office should be a reflection of who you are, so go ahead and embrace the quirks that make you unique. Personalizing your office is not just about aesthetics; it's about creating a space where creativity and productivity can flourish.
What Are the Best Colors for a Fun and Productive Workspace?
Creating a workspace that fosters both fun and productivity is essential for maintaining motivation and creativity. Research in color psychology suggests that different colors can evoke varying emotional responses. For instance, blue is known for its calming effects and ability to stimulate concentration, making it an ideal choice for a workspace where focus is paramount. On the other hand, vibrant colors like yellow can inspire creativity and energy. This makes it a great accent color to pair with more subdued tones in your office decor.
It’s important to balance colors in your workspace to avoid overwhelming your senses. Consider a neutral palette for the primary elements, such as the walls and furniture, and then incorporate pops of color through accessories like artwork, pillows, or even desk items. The combination of these colors allows for both a fun atmosphere and a conducive environment for productivity. Here are some color combinations that can work effectively:
- Blue and Yellow: Calming yet energizing.
- Green and White: Refreshing and peaceful.
- Orange Accents: Invigorating touch.
